PASS Support-UTC BOT EOT ---Station------ Local Time ----------------- ------------ --- --- ---------------- ---------- (none) MP: Working on the next load S/C: We held CAP reviews this morning: CAP 1100 for reconfiguring EPHIN and a CAP to patch the associated K constants to the new configuration. We will also have a CAP review tomorrow or Wednesday for the beginning of the upcoming eclipse season. The plan for EPHIN is to reconfigure it tomorrow, in either early morning or afternoon. Because detector A in EPHIN is experiencing high rates from internal noise as a result of increasing temperatures, it will be turned off. Portions of detector B will also be turned off. Consequently, the coincidence logic must be changed. We will also add an HRC MCP total rate to RADMON monitoring for additional protection. This will only provide a trigger if the MCP HV is at an operational level. The new monitored quantities will be: Name Contents Trigger value ---- -------------------------------- ------------- E150 = E150(old) + P4GM + H4GM + B_noise 800000 E1300 = E1300 + P25GM + H25GM 1000 1000 HRC 30. Thus, the new E150 and E1300 will no longer be just electrons, but will be a combination of electrons and ions (protons, helium, etc.). We have done studies that assure the new quantities will provide adequate monitoring to protect Chandra. The EPHIN configuration change will impact the following ground procedures and software: SOP_OPS_SOLAR_ACTIVITY, SOP_SAFE_SAFING_ACTIONS, Limits monitoring, GRETA and EHS displays, SOT MTA alerts. The new configuration also changes the calibration file used in CXCDS. A new calibration file is to be installed on CXCDS. Finally, the section of this shift report that reports "Radiation Measurement" will be changed accordingly, beginning with the first shift report following the execution of the CAPs, expected tomorrow.
